South Africa Automotive Rain Sensor Market Synopsis

The South Africa Automotive Rain Sensor Market is witnessing steady growth driven by increasing awareness about road safety and the rising demand for advanced driver assistance systems. Rain sensors are becoming a crucial component in vehicles as they automatically detect rainfall and activate windshield wipers, enhancing driving visibility and safety. The market is also benefiting from the growing preference for technologically advanced vehicles among consumers in South Africa. Key players in the market are focusing on product innovations and strategic partnerships to gain a competitive edge. Additionally, stringent government regulations mandating the installation of safety features in vehicles are further propelling the demand for automotive rain sensors in South Africa. Overall, the market is poised for continued growth as automotive manufacturers prioritize safety and convenience features in their vehicles.

South Africa Automotive Rain Sensor Market Challenges

In the South Africa Automotive Rain Sensor Market, challenges include the relatively low awareness and adoption of advanced driver assistance systems (ADAS) such as rain sensors among consumers and automakers. This is partly due to the perception of these technologies as expensive and not essential in a market where cost-consciousness is prevalent. Additionally, the lack of standardization and regulations around ADAS technologies in South Africa poses a challenge for manufacturers in terms of product development and market penetration. Moreover, the limited availability of skilled technicians for installation and maintenance of rain sensors further hinders the growth of this market segment. Overall, overcoming these challenges requires education and awareness campaigns, regulatory support, and investment in training programs to enhance the uptake of automotive rain sensors in South Africa.

South Africa Automotive Rain Sensor Market Government Polices

The South Africa Automotive Rain Sensor Market is influenced by government policies aimed at promoting the development and growth of the automotive industry. The government has implemented various initiatives to incentivize local manufacturing and assembly of vehicles, including tax incentives, grants, and subsidies. Additionally, policies such as the Automotive Production and Development Programme (APDP) promote local procurement and value addition in the automotive sector, which indirectly impacts the demand for automotive rain sensors. Furthermore, regulations related to vehicle safety and environmental standards also affect the market, as manufacturers are required to comply with certain specifications for vehicle components like rain sensors. Overall, government policies in South Africa play a significant role in shaping the automotive rain sensor market by encouraging local production, ensuring quality standards, and promoting sustainable practices in the industry.

The key competitors in the South Africa automotive rain sensor market include companies like Bosch, Valeo, and HELLA. Bosch is known for its advanced sensor technologies and strong global presence, while Valeo focuses on innovation and quality. HELLA, on the other hand, is recognized for its reliable and cost-effective rain sensor solutions. These companies dominate the market with their competitive pricing strategies and diversified product portfolios, catering to the varying needs of automotive manufacturers and consumers in South Africa.
